About Cadia

Our Cadia Valley Operation in New South Wales is situated about 25 kilometers from Orange and 250 kilometers west of Sydney. Cadia produces gold doré bars from a gravity circuit and gold-rich copper concentrates from a flotation circuit. The operation includes the Cadia East Mine which is globally renowned for its use of block caving, a large-scale underground mining method. We acknowledge the Wiradjuri people, traditional custodians of the land surrounding Cadia, and proudly run an Indigenous Buddy Program to enrich the workplace experience for our Indigenous employees. As a residential (drive-in / drive-out) mine, Cadia values community deeply, offering both financial and in-kind support to organizations across Blayney, Cabonne, and Orange townships. Who We're Looking For

We are seeking an experienced Advisor Maintenance to support safe, compliant and cost‐efficient delivery of non‐processing infrastructure across Cadia. This is a key site-wide role providing technical coordination, governance and oversight of lifting & rigging, scaffolding, fire systems, fuel facilities, air compressors and general ancillary maintenance activities. You will act as the central point of contact between planners, supervisors, contractors and asset teams to ensure work is correctly scoped, approved, executed and documented.

Responsibilities

* Coordinate pre‐lift inspections, CraneSafe certifications, scaffold audits and associated documentation
* Maintain and audit lifting, rigging, scaffold and anchor point registers in line with Australian Standards
* Act as the primary site contact for ancillary non‐processing infrastructure maintenance activities
* Build and review maintenance work packs with planners and supervisors to minimise rework and control cost
* Monitor contractor performance across scaffolding and crane services, escalating safety, statutory or commercial risks early
* Support outage and shutdown preparation, execution and improvement initiatives
* Drive continuous improvement in systems, processes and contractor delivery

Qualifications

* Demonstrated experience in surface fixed plant or ancillary maintenance within mining or heavy industry
* Strong knowledge of lifting & rigging, scaffolding systems and statutory compliance
* Proven ability to coordinate contractors and interface with multiple stakeholders
* Well‐developed planning, organisational and analytical skills
* Leadership capability with experience influencing safe work behaviours
* Working knowledge of maintenance systems, SAP cost reporting and Gantt-based planning
* Behaviours aligned with Newmont values, with a visible commitment to safety leadership

This is a residential, Monday to Friday role offering a 9‐day fortnight option. Standard working hours are 6:00am to 3:00pm, with flexibility required during outages and critical works. Unrestricted Australian working rights are essential.
